  • Swift属性

    属性的存储

     

    属性的主要作用是存储数据。能够常量属性和变量属 性;

    struct FixedLengthRange {
    var firstValue: Int let length: Int
    }
    var rangeOfThreeItems =FixedLengthRange(firstValue: 0,
    length: 3) 
    // the range represents integer values 0, 1, and2 rangeOfThreeItems.firstValue = 6
    // the range now represents integer values 6, 7, and 8

    可是 rangeOfFourItems 实例为常量属性也是不能够改动的。

    l

    et rangeOfFourItems = FixedLengthRange(firstValue: 0, length: 4)
    // this range represents integer values 0, 1, 2, and 3 rangeOfFourItems.firstValue = 6

    延时存储属性

    延时存储属性是初始化时候不分配值,直到第一次使 用它。

    属性@lazy 声明。

    计算属性

    有的时候一些属性是通过其它的属性计算得出的,通 过 get 和 set 訪问器对其訪问。

    //定义 Point struct Point {
    var x =0.0, y = 0.0
    }
    //定义 Size struct Size {
    var width = 0.0, height = 0.0
    }
    //定义 Rect struct Rect {
    var origin = Point()
    var size = Size()
    var center: Point {
    get {
    let centerX = origin.x+ (size.width / 2)
    let centerY = origin.y + (size.height / 2)
    return Point(x: centerX, y: centerY)
    }
    set(newCenter) {
    origin.x = newCenter.x - (size.width / 2)
    origin.y = newCenter.y - (size.height / 2) 
    }
    }
    }
    var square =Rect(origin: Point(x: 0.0, y: 0.0), size: Size( 10.0,height: 10.0))
    let initialSquareCenter =square.center square.center = Point(x: 15.0, y: 15.0) println("square.origin is  now    at  ((square.origin.x),
    (square.origin.y))")
     

     

    属性观察者

     

    为了监听属性的变化。swift 通过了属性观察者。

     

    • willSet 观察者是在存储之前调用。

    • didSet 新值存储后调用。

    静态属性

     

    静态属性在结构体中使用 static 定义,类中使用 class

    定义。

    struct SomeStructure {
    static var storedTypeProperty = "Some value."static var computedTypeProperty: Int{
    // return anInt value here 
    }
    }
    class SomeClass {
    class varcomputedTypeProperty: Int {
    // return anInt value here
    }
    }

    调用的时候能够直接使用类和结构体名调用。
